This got refactored upstream. Test: checkbuild and ./run_tests.py Change-Id: I801869923cf7c51528de354f8a3da705f188ff43
14 lines
368 B
Python
14 lines
368 B
Python
import os
|
|
import subprocess
|
|
|
|
|
|
def mm(path, android_build_top):
|
|
env = os.environ
|
|
env['ONE_SHOT_MAKEFILE'] = os.path.join(path, 'Android.mk')
|
|
|
|
cmd = [
|
|
'make', '-C', android_build_top, '-f', 'build/core/main.mk',
|
|
'MODULES-IN-' + path.replace('/', '-'), '-B'
|
|
]
|
|
return not subprocess.Popen(cmd, stdout=None, stderr=None, env=env).wait()
|